[0031] The present invention will be further described below in conjunction with the accompanying drawings and embodiments.

[0032] Such as figure 1 Shown, root cutting method of the present invention, adopts double-sided cutter, oblique direction, the mode of operation of successively different cross-section burying, and cutter random tool traction direction advances longitudinally.

[0033] The depth of the above-mentioned root cutting operation is 200mm, and the distance between the slits on both sides is determined according to the angle of entry into the soil. The relationship is d=2h·tanα, where d is the slit distance between the two cutters; α is the distance between the cutter plane and the vertical plane. The included angle is the angle of entry into the soil. The entry angle is preferably 19° to 45°. Usually, three angles of 19°, 30° and 45° are selected; h is the entry depth of the cutter.

Abstract

The invention discloses a method and device for removing grassland weeds-iridaceous plants. In the method, cutters on both sides are used for obliquely cutting roots in soil in turn from different cross sections. The device comprises a frame, wherein the frame is provided with a transverse positioning hydraulic cylinder and a sliding plate; two ends of the sliding plate are arranged on the frame through slide blocks; the transverse positioning hydraulic cylinder is connected with one slide block; a pair of positive bars is arranged in the center of the sliding plate; the left side and the right side of each positive bar are provided with a group of angle adjusting devices respectively; the two groups of angle adjusting devices are arranged front and back in a staggered way; each group of angle adjusting devices is connected with a working hydraulic cylinder respectively; the lower end of each working hydraulic cylinder is connected with a cutter saddle; a hydraulic motor is fixedly connected with the cutter saddle and is connected with a cutter head; 3-4 cutters are uniformly distributed in the circumferential direction of the cutter head; and a left group of cutters and a right group of cutters are obliquely and oppositely arranged in a V shape. A practicable scheme is provided for the removal of iridaceous plants, and the method is suitable for improving grasslands degraded by heavy weed growth, is accordant with the concept of agricultural sustainable development, and has an extensive application prospect.

technical field [0001] The invention belongs to the technical field of weed removal, and in particular relates to a removal method and a special removal device for Iridaceae plants such as Malian. Background technique [0002] At present, most of the grasslands in China are in a degraded state, and the degradation of some grasslands is manifested in the obvious reduction of the number of grasses in the original dominant species, while the Iridaceae plants that most domestic animals do not like to eat, such as Malian, are proliferating in large numbers. Group species of pastures form intense competition, which affects grass production and economic benefits, and causes grassland degradation. Therefore, in order to improve the population structure of such degraded grasslands, it is necessary to remove the mixed Iridaceae weeds.
